Website. www .nashuanh .gov. Nashua ( / ˈnæʃəwʌ /) is a city in southern New Hampshire, United States. As of the 2020 census, it had a population of 91,322, [ 5 ] the second-largest in northern New England after nearby Manchester. It is one of two county seats of New Hampshire's most populous county, Hillsborough; the other being Manchester.

November 25, 1980. Designated CP. December 13, 1984. The Gen. George Stark House is a historic house at 22 Concord Street in Nashua, New Hampshire. Built in 1856, is one New Hampshire's finest Italianate houses. The house was listed on the National Register of Historic Places in 1980, [ 1] and included in the Nashville Historic District in 1984.
